核心点:forEach方法可以直接访问到Map对象的键和值,简化了遍历操作。 2. 使用for…of循环 for...of循环同样可以用来遍历Map对象,但需要使用entries()方法。 let map = new Map(); map.set('a', 1); map.set('b', 2); map.set('c', 3); for (let [key, value] of map.entries()) { consol...
//遍历map $.map(map_demo,function(key,value){ console.log(key+":"+value); }); 小结:$.map()写法和$.each()类似,但对list的遍历时,参数顺序和$.each()是相反的,并且可以带返回值。对map的遍历和$.each()一样 ——— 版权声明:本文为CSDN博主「98年的香奈儿」的原创文章,遵循CC 4.0 BY-SA版...
在JavaScript中,遍历一个包含Map对象的List(即数组)通常涉及两层循环:外层循环遍历List中的每个元素(每个元素都是一个Map),内层循环遍历Map的键值对。以下是如何实现这一过程的详细步骤: 1. 确认数据结构 假设我们有如下的数据结构: javascript let list = [ new Map([['key1', 'value1'], ['key2', 'val...
在JavaScript中,Map对象是一种键值对的集合,其中的键和值可以是任何类型的数据。遍历Map对象可以通过for…of循环、forEach方法等方式来实现。 使用for…of循环遍历Map对象 letmap=newMap();map.set('name','Alice');map.set('age',30);for(let[key,value]ofmap){console.log(key+': '+value);} 1. 2...
和Map。 List遍历:遍历List中的元素,对每个元素执行操作。 代码语言:javascript 复制 for(ElementType element:list){// 操作element} Map遍历:遍历Map中的键值对,对每对键值对执行操作。 代码语言:javascript 复制 java复制代码for(Map.Entry<KeyType,ValueType>entry:map.entrySet()){KeyType key=entry.getKey(...
js中循环java的listmap js循环遍历map 关于JS循环遍历 写下这篇文章的目的,主要是想总结一下关于JS对于集合对象遍历的方式方法,以及在实际应用场景中怎样去使用它们。本文会主要介绍:while,for,forEach,every,some,filter,reduce,map,indexOf… while/do while...
var map_demo = { name: "John", lang: "JS" }; 1.最常用的for循环 for(vari=0;i<list2.length;i++){ console.info(i+":"+list2 [i]); } 小结:很常见也很常用,效率也不差,但不能遍历map。 2.for...in...遍历List/map //遍历mapfor(varkeyinmap_demo){ ...
JS中对List、Map的各种遍历⽅式 var list1 = ["number","name"];var list2 = ["36","Crown","15","Faker","Swift","68","Dandy"];var map_demo = { name: "John", lang: "JS" };1.最常⽤的for循环 for(var i=0;i<list2.length;i++){ console.info(i +":"+ list2 [i]);...
4. map 方法:数组对象的map方法可以对数组中的每个元素执行一个函数,并返回一个新的数组。 varlist=[1,2,3,4,5];varnewList=list.map(function(item){returnitem*2;});console.log(newList); 这些是 JavaScript 中常用的几种遍历列表的方式
js中遍历java 返回的listmap数组 js如何遍历list 数组的很多方法都可以实现对数组的操作,但是在使用的时候,有时候能够用对方法,往往能够达到事半功倍的效果 方法1—for of—得到每一次迭代的值 for of是配合iterator迭代器使用的,js默认为数组,字符串,argument,set容器,map容器部署了iterator接口,除了这五种类型,...